bash 变量替换和引用
作者:mishar 提问时间:2/10/2020
也许这是一个简单的问题,但我想知道引号如何使用变量。变量值周围的引号是否也会被替换为该变量? 例如: fred="\*" echo $fred 结果为输出: \* 为什么?我认为这会被替换...
BASH 问答列表
作者:mishar 提问时间:2/10/2020
也许这是一个简单的问题,但我想知道引号如何使用变量。变量值周围的引号是否也会被替换为该变量? 例如: fred="\*" echo $fred 结果为输出: \* 为什么?我认为这会被替换...
作者:rzlvmp 提问时间:10/5/2022
这个问题在这里已经有答案了: 如何在 Bash 中为变量分配 heredoc 值? (14 个回答) 去年关闭。 假设我有一个代码,如下所示: python <<EOF print("abc") ...
作者:Pavel 提问时间:5/5/2023
这个问题在这里已经有答案了: 如何猫 <<EOF >>包含代码的文件? (6 个答案) 7个月前关闭。 我正在尝试在EOF块内执行命令的PID。 $ bash << EOF > sleep 10...
作者:abalter 提问时间:5/8/2023
使用 heredoc 代替文本文件似乎适用于:python (base) balter@exahead1:~$ python <<EOF print("hello") EOF hello 但是,...
作者:Christian Bongiorno 提问时间:9/6/2023
因此,我试图通过将要执行的脚本包装在“页眉”和“页脚”中来将一些默认配置应用于每次调用,以便获得一致的执行。sqlplus 但是,当我实现这个 bash 函数时,我意识到某些脚本具有参数,当我尝试在...
作者:Mathias Bynens 提问时间:11/12/2010
假设我有以下 Bash 脚本: while read SCRIPT_SOURCE_LINE; do echo "$SCRIPT_SOURCE_LINE" done 我注意到,对于末尾没有换行符...
作者:Ashutosh 提问时间:9/23/2018
这是我的脚本,其中我使用远程计算机中的局部变量。但是 下的循环只接受第一个变量值。循环在 内部运行良好,但具有相同的值。heredocheredocheredoc #!/bin/bash prod_...
作者:gonzalloe 提问时间:7/21/2022
我使用下面的docker-compose脚本构建了一个容器: services: client: image: alpine environment: - BACKUP_ENABLED=1 ...
作者:burble_gurp007 提问时间:11/13/2022
我有一个 bash 脚本,它是一个简单的日历应用程序。每当我运行它时,只要我输入,脚本就会终止,并且我收到消息: “./addtocalendar-jrussial.sh:第 104 行:语法错误:...
作者:Max 提问时间:2/9/2023
根据要求更新 这里将使用一些基本的日期变量。 month=$(date +%b) day=$(date -d "today" '+%d') 现在。。。 我有一个字符串,我需要分配给一个变量,...